Webster

chanson de geste ()

Any Old French epic poem having for its subject events or exploits of early French history, real or legendary, and written originally in assonant verse of ten or twelve syllables. The most famous one is the Chanson de Roland.

A chanson de geste is a medieval French epic poem that recounts heroic deeds and adventures.

The Song of Roland is one of the most famous chansons de geste, celebrating the legendary deeds of Charlemagne's knight Roland.

Chansons de geste were often performed orally by traveling minstrels or jongleurs.

These epic poems were composed in Old French and typically written in verse form.
